Product reviews:
Ryan
2025-02-17 iphone XS Max
Hot Wheels Turbo Racing - Nintendo 64 hot wheels turbo racing pc
hot wheels turbo racing pc
Keith
2025-02-23 iphone 11
Hot Wheels Turbo Racing (PS1 Gameplay) hot wheels turbo racing pc
hot wheels turbo racing pc
Hayden
2025-02-25 iphone 7
Hot Wheels Turbo Racing [N64/PS1 hot wheels turbo racing pc
hot wheels turbo racing pc
Jonathan
2025-02-23 iphone SE
Nintendo 64 Hot Wheels - Turbo Racing hot wheels turbo racing pc
hot wheels turbo racing pc